What Are Fake Casino Clones?

Fake casino clones are illegitimate online gambling sites that mimic the design and offerings of reputable casinos. These sites often use similar branding and promotional materials to deceive players into thinking they are visiting a legitimate gambling establishment. What sets these clones apart is their lack of proper licensing and regulatory oversight, which is a hallmark of trustworthy online casinos.

The Illusion of Legitimacy

Cloned casinos often go to great lengths to create an illusion of legitimacy. They may use professional-looking websites, offer popular games, and even provide customer support to appear credible. However, players need to remain vigilant, as these features can easily be fabricated.

Identifying Fake Casinos

Recognizing a fake casino clone can be challenging, but there are certain red flags that players should watch for. One major indicator is the absence of a valid gaming license; reputable online casinos are usually licensed by recognized regulatory bodies. Additionally, players should be cautious of sites that offer unrealistic winnings and bonuses that seem too good to be true.

The Consequences of Playing at Fake Casinos

Playing at fake casino clones can have severe consequences. Not only do players risk losing their money, but they may also face potential identity theft, as these sites often collect personal information without proper security measures. Furthermore, involvement with these clones can lead to a tarnished gambling experience, as players are left feeling frustrated and cheated.

Protecting Yourself Online

To protect yourself from falling prey to fake casino clones, always ensure you’re playing at licensed and regulated platforms. Look for SSL encryption indicators, read terms and conditions thoroughly, and never share sensitive information with sites that do not have a solid reputation.
